We take care to train our dancers according to individual capability. Ballet
is a discipline that takes many years to achieve the strength, co-ordination
and skills required to execute the technical steps. Children must be prepared
physically and mentally. They are able to perform many movements, but technique
must be developed carefully. This requires PATIENCE from both the students
and parents. Pointe shoes should NEVER be attempted before the leg muscles,
body and feet are strong enough to handle all the EXTRA stress. It is very
unwise for the young child to even try. The soft under developed feet bones
may become dislocated because the muscles that support the body weight
are not yet developed to protect them. So as the child grows older and
heavier the malformation can become critical, ruining a hobby, or career,
before it has begun.
